U.S. Bank Account Requirements for Web Developers in Cameroon
Web developers in Cameroon often face a specific hurdle when seeking a U.S. bank account: the need for a U.S. Taxpayer Identification Number, either an ITIN or an EIN, even if they don't reside in the U.S. Many U.S. banks have strict Know Your Customer (KYC) and Anti-Money Laundering (AML) policies that require a U.S. TIN for account opening. Without one, your application will likely be declined. This is a primary friction point for freelance web developers in Cameroon who receive payments from U.S. clients. The ITIN, or Individual Taxpayer Identification Number, is issued by the IRS to individuals who need a U.S. tax processing number but do not have and are not eligible for a Social Security Number (SSN). For business purposes, an Employer Identification Number (EIN) is often required, especially if you plan to form a U.S. entity like an LLC. The absence of a U.S. tax ID is the most significant barrier for non-residents looking to establish a U.S. financial foothold.
This requirement stems from U.S. financial regulations designed to prevent financial crime and ensure tax compliance. While some fintech solutions might appear to offer easier onboarding, most still require a U.S. TIN. The process for obtaining an ITIN involves filing Form W-7 with the IRS, either by mail or through a Certified Acceptance Agent (CAA). For an EIN, you would file Form SS-4 with the IRS. Each of these steps adds complexity and time to the overall goal of opening a U.S. bank account. Understanding these prerequisites upfront is key to a successful application. Without addressing the U.S. TIN requirement first, any attempt to open a U.S. bank account will likely be unsuccessful.
When a U.S. Bank Account Becomes Necessary
For web developers in Cameroon, a U.S. bank account is often triggered by the need to receive payments from U.S. clients efficiently and compliantly. Many U.S. clients prefer or require paying into a U.S. bank account to simplify their own accounting and reduce international wire transfer fees. Furthermore, U.S. clients who are businesses may need to issue tax forms, such as Form 1099-NEC, to their independent contractors. To issue these forms accurately, they often require the contractor's U.S. Taxpayer Identification Number (TIN), which for an individual would be an ITIN. Without a U.S. TIN, your U.S. clients may be unable to pay you without withholding taxes at the highest rate, or they might simply choose to work with contractors who can provide the necessary documentation.
Establishing a U.S. LLC also frequently necessitates a U.S. bank account. While you can form a U.S. LLC remotely, many U.S. banks will require proof of U.S. business operations or a U.S. address to open an account. A U.S. bank account can serve as that verifiable U.S. presence. Additionally, some payment platforms or third-party services used by web developers may offer better rates or more seamless integration when linked to a U.S. bank account. For developers operating internationally, having a U.S. dollar-denominated account can also help manage currency exchange fluctuations and simplify financial planning. The decision to open a U.S. bank account is therefore driven by client requirements, tax compliance, and operational efficiency.
Required Documentation for Opening a U.S. Bank Account
Opening a U.S. bank account as a non-resident developer from Cameroon typically requires a specific set of documents, starting with a U.S. Taxpayer Identification Number (TIN). This will be either an ITIN or an EIN. If you are applying for an ITIN, you will need to submit Form W-7, Application for IRS Individual Taxpayer Identification Number. Supporting this application are original or certified copies of your identification documents. The primary document is usually your passport, which must be valid. You will also need a proof of foreign address, which can be a utility bill or a bank statement from your country of residence.
If you are opening a business account, particularly after forming a U.S. LLC, you will need an EIN. The document proving your EIN is the EIN confirmation letter (CP 575) issued by the IRS upon successful application for the EIN. Other documents for a business account may include the Articles of Organization for your U.S. LLC, an Operating Agreement, and potentially a business license or permit depending on the state and bank. Some banks may also request a proof of address for the business, which can be more challenging for a remote entity. It is essential to have all these documents ready and accurately filled out before starting the bank application process to avoid delays. Review the specific requirements of your chosen bank, as they can vary.
The U.S. Bank Account Application Process
The process to open a U.S. bank account for web developers in Cameroon generally begins after you have secured a U.S. Taxpayer Identification Number (TIN). If you need an ITIN, you can apply by mail directly to the IRS or through a Certified Acceptance Agent (CAA). itin.net acts as a CAA, which can streamline the ITIN application by verifying your original identification documents, reducing the risk of them being lost in the mail. Once you have your ITIN or EIN, you can proceed with opening the bank account. This typically involves an online application with the chosen bank or fintech provider.
This application will require you to provide your personal information, U.S. TIN, and details about your business or freelance activity. You will upload scanned copies of your identification documents and any business formation documents if applicable. The bank will then conduct its KYC and AML checks. The typical timeline from submitting a complete application to having an active U.S. bank account, including receiving a debit card, is 5–10 business days. Some fintech solutions may offer faster activation, but the initial verification process remains crucial. Be prepared for potential follow-up questions from the bank to clarify any information provided in your application.
Common Pitfalls for Cameroonian Web Developers
Web developers in Cameroon encounter specific pitfalls when applying for U.S. bank accounts. A primary mistake is attempting to open an account without first obtaining a U.S. Taxpayer Identification Number (TIN). Many banks, especially traditional ones, will outright reject applications lacking an ITIN or EIN. This is a non-negotiable requirement for non-resident applicants. Another common error is applying to banks that do not support non-resident account openings. Most large national banks have stringent policies against opening accounts for individuals without a U.S. physical address and SSN or ITIN/EIN, making them unsuitable candidates.
Missing or incorrect documentation is another frequent issue. This can range from submitting expired identification to providing incomplete business formation documents. For instance, if you form a U.S. LLC, ensure your Articles of Organization and Operating Agreement are correctly drafted and submitted. Failing to provide a clear proof of address, especially for a remote business, can also lead to rejection. Web developers might also overlook the importance of matching information across all documents – your name, address, and TIN must be consistent. Finally, attempting to use a U.S. address that is not genuinely associated with your business or personal presence can raise red flags during the bank's verification process. This is particularly relevant if you are using a mail forwarding service without proper disclosure.
The Certified Acceptance Agent (CAA) Advantage
Utilizing a Certified Acceptance Agent (CAA) for your ITIN application offers significant advantages, especially for web developers in Cameroon. As a CAA, itin.net can authenticate your original identification documents, such as your passport, directly. This means you do not have to mail your original, irreplaceable documents to the IRS, mitigating the risk of loss or damage during transit. The CAA acts as an intermediary, verifying your identity and certifying that the copies submitted with your Form W-7 are true and accurate representations of your originals.
This verification process through a CAA can also expedite the ITIN application. By ensuring all documentation is correctly completed and verified upfront, the chances of an ITIN application being rejected due to procedural errors are significantly reduced. For a web developer in Cameroon, this is invaluable. It saves time and reduces the stress associated with navigating IRS procedures remotely. The CAA service essentially provides a smoother, more secure path to obtaining the necessary ITIN, which is the critical first step towards opening a U.S. bank account. While you can apply for an ITIN directly, the CAA route offers a layer of security and efficiency that is highly beneficial for international applicants.
Next Steps After Opening Your U.S. Bank Account
With your U.S. bank account established, you can now receive payments from U.S. clients more efficiently. Ensure you provide your new U.S. bank account details, including routing and account numbers, to your clients. If you formed a U.S. LLC, you may need to link this bank account to your business structure for accounting and tax purposes. Remember that even with a U.S. bank account, you may still have U.S. tax filing obligations, especially if you are receiving income from U.S. sources. This could include filing Form 1040-NR (U.S. Nonresident Alien Income Tax Return) if your U.S. source income exceeds certain thresholds, or Form 5472 if you have a U.S. LLC and are a foreign-owned entity.
For web developers in Cameroon, it is prudent to consult with a tax professional specializing in international taxation to understand your specific U.S. tax obligations. The absence of a U.S.–Cameroon income tax treaty means that U.S. tax rules apply directly. Reviewing your pricing and payment structures to ensure they align with U.S. tax regulations is also advisable. Consider exploring itin.net's Banking Bundle which includes EIN and LLC formation support, or their Basic Banking Setup service if you already have your TIN. For personalized guidance on your unique situation, reaching out to itin.net for assistance is a recommended next step.
Practical tips
- Obtain your U.S. Taxpayer Identification Number (ITIN or EIN) before applying for a U.S. bank account. Most banks require this for non-resident applications.
- Use your full legal name as it appears on your passport for all applications (ITIN, bank account) to avoid name mismatch errors.
- For business accounts, ensure your U.S. LLC formation documents, including Articles of Organization and Operating Agreement, are complete and accurate.
- Choose a bank or fintech provider known to accept non-resident applications. Research their specific requirements for individuals based in countries like Cameroon.
- Keep digital copies of all submitted documents and application confirmations for your records. This aids in tracking progress and addressing any potential issues.
Frequently asked questions
Can I open a U.S. bank account remotely from Cameroon without visiting the U.S.?
Yes, it is possible to open a U.S. bank account remotely from Cameroon. The process typically requires obtaining a U.S. Taxpayer Identification Number (ITIN or EIN) first, followed by an online application with a bank or fintech provider that supports non-resident account openings.
What is the difference between an ITIN and an EIN for opening a U.S. bank account?
An ITIN (Individual Taxpayer Identification Number) is for individuals who need a U.S. tax ID but are not eligible for an SSN. An EIN (Employer Identification Number) is for businesses, including U.S. LLCs. Many banks require one of these for non-resident account applications; an EIN is often needed for business accounts.
How long does it take to get a U.S. bank account after I have my ITIN/EIN?
After successfully obtaining your ITIN or EIN, the application process for a U.S. bank account typically takes 5–10 business days from submission to account activation, including receiving your debit card.
Do I need a U.S. address to open a U.S. bank account?
While some banks may require a U.S. address for business accounts, many fintech solutions and some traditional banks allow non-residents to open accounts using their foreign address, provided they have a valid U.S. TIN.
Are there any U.S. tax implications for web developers in Cameroon with a U.S. bank account?
Yes, earning income from U.S. clients may create U.S. tax filing obligations. Even with a U.S. bank account, you may need to file U.S. tax returns like Form 1040-NR or Form 5472 (if you have a U.S. LLC). Consult a tax professional specializing in international tax.
Can itin.net help me get both an ITIN and a U.S. bank account?
Yes, itin.net can assist with obtaining your ITIN through our Certified Acceptance Agent services. We also offer services to help set up your U.S. LLC and EIN, which are often prerequisites for opening a U.S. business bank account. We can guide you through the entire process.



